cameraservice: Migrate all internal String8/String16s to std::string
String8 and String16 are deprecated classes. It is recommended to use
std::string or std::u16string wherever possible. String16 is the native
string class for aidl, but Strings marked @utf8InCpp can use std::string
directly.
This patch standardizes libcameraservice's use of strings to
std::string, which is capable of storing utf-8 strings. This makes the
code more readable and potentially reduces the number of string copies
to a minimum.
A new set of string utils is added to frameworks/av/camera to aid this
migration.
